In the following circuit diagram, the current through the battery is

Options

  1. A4   A
  2. B3   A
  3. C1   A
  4. D2   A

Correct answer

D. 2   A

Step-by-step solution

From the figure, It is clear that diodes D 1 and D 3 are reverse biased, therefore they will not conduct any current and the resistance of 11   Ω and 5   Ω will be not in use. The diode D 2 is forward biased, therefore the current flowing through the diode D 2 is same as the current through the battery. On redrawing the circuit as shown, we can obtain the value of current as i = 20 7 + 3 = 2   A
